Since opening its doors in 1895, the Alliance Française de Sydney has been at the heart of Franco–Australian cultural dialogue. Over 130 years, we’ve nurtured the French language and Francophone culture here in Sydney through language courses, cinema, lectures, exhibitions, and community events.
